February 2, 2022Whether you’re single or in a relationship, Valentine's Day is the perfect time to celebrate all the love in your life, from self-love, to romantic love, to platonic love.
The history and origins of Valentine’s Day aren’t quite clear, but the holiday is related to different saints of the Catholic Church, the pagan celebration of a fertility festival called Lupercalia, and the beginning of birds’ mating season.

Valentine’s Day Makers’ Market
Head over to Federal Hill on Saturday, February 12th from 12:00-5:00 p.m. to shop at Cross Street Market for all your Valentine’s Day needs. At the Market, you’ll find a florist, bakehouse, homemade candles, chocolates, and more to buy your loved ones some special gifts.
Berries by Quicha
Who doesn’t love a box of gourmet chocolate covered strawberries? Berries by Quicha makes gourmet chocolate strawberries locally that you can gift to your lovers. You can shop online or in-person at one of their several locations in Baltimore for their delicious yet gorgeous berries.

Fleur De Lis
For over 28 years, Fleur De Lis has provided downtown Baltimore with premier, custom floral arrangements. They work with local growers and locally source flowers whenever possible. Shop online or go visit their store on Lexington Street and pick up the most gorgeous flowers to add a little bit of life and color to your loved one’s space.

TigerLilly
If you’ve got a special someone who can’t get enough jewelry, head over to Mount Vernon Marketplace to pick her up a new piece from TigerLilly. Artist Allison Formich creates all the unique mixed metal jewelry herself from natural specimens collected from the environment. You won’t find anything else like it!
